About

Andrew Alan Ponnock is a bankruptcy and debt attorney with 26 years of legal experience, practicing at The Law Offices of Andrew A. Ponnock, PLC in Coral Springs, FL. He earned a B.A. from Barry University in 1995 and a J.D. from Nova Southeastern University - Shepard Broad Law Center in 1999. He has been admitted to the Florida Bar since 2000. His practice encompasses bankruptcy and debt, debt settlement, and foreclosure, allowing him to serve clients across a range of legal needs. He maintains a clean professional disciplinary record.
